      Galaxy Watch 4 is the sporty version of Samsung's flagship watch series. It was launched alongside its Classic sibling in August of 2021. It drops the "Classic" rotating bezel in favor of a trendier look. The color options are also more exciting here. Galaxy Watch 4 is also among the first smartwatches to come with Wear OS 3, the merger platform between Tizen OS and Google's Wear OS. As a result, you can expect wider third-party app support compared to previous-gen Galaxy watches.

      Samsung Galaxy Watch 4 Overview:

      Design, Display

      Of the two watches in Samsung's flagship smartwatch lineup for 2021, Samsung Galaxy Watch 4 sports a more sporty look. It doesn't have the rotating bezel of its Classic sibling, which allows it to have a more compact form factor despite featuring the same display size options. Furthermore, the watch cases are made of Aluminum instead of stainless steel. Available in 40 and 44mm case sizes, the case itself is made of stainless steel. Both options can be fitted with a 20mm (universal) strap. In terms of durability, the watch is 5 ATM water-resistant and IP68 certified against dust and water damage. Moreover, it has passed MIL-STD-810G tests for durability against extreme temperatures, shock, vibration, dust, and humidity. The Galaxy Watch 4 Classic 40mm and 44mm weigh 25.9 and 30.3 grams, respectively.

      Getting to the display, you're looking at either a 1.2 or a 1.4" Super AMOLED panel protected by Corning's Gorilla Glass DX+. For navigation, there are two customizable buttons on the side. These buttons are also used to take "Body Composition" readings.

      Health, Fitness Tracking

      Using something called a 3-in-1 BioActive sensor, the Watch 4 can measure your body fat, skeletal muscle, body water, and Basal Metabolic Rate (BMR). Apart from this, it can monitor your heart rate, sleep, stress, and blood oxygen (SpO2) levels. Complementing the sleep tracking feature, this smartwatch can detect your snoring as well.

      Samsung Galaxy Watch 4 Blood Pressure ECG Availability
      It also supports blood pressure and ECG measurement but this feature is exclusive to select regions only. Moreover, the Watch 4 can record 95 types of workouts like walking, running, hiking, swimming, and more. As expected, there's built-in GPS too, which means you can trail your workout routes without needing a smartphone.

      Performance

      Powering the Galaxy Watch 4 is Samsung's own Exynos W920 processor. Built on a more power-efficient 5nm process node, this processor has a 20% more powerful CPU and 10x more powerful GPU compared to the Exynos 9110 in last year's Watch 3 and Watch Active 2. This has been complemented by 1.5GB RAM and 16GB of internal storage.

      Exynos W920 Wearable Processor
      On the software side of things, the Watch 4 runs on Wear OS (with One UI Watch 3 on top) instead of the company's own Tizen OS that we've seen in previous Galaxy watches. Like the flagship Galaxy S22 series and some of the recent Galaxy A smartphones, the Watch 4 is also slated to receive 4 years of Wear OS and One UI Watch updates.

      Others

      The Galaxy Watch 4 has either a 247 or a 361mAh battery. And it should last about a day or a day and a half under normal usage. By the way, this smartwatch is only compatible with Android phones running on Marshmallow (6.0) or newer versions; with at least 1.5GB RAM. On the other hand, all the health data recorded by the watch is synced to your Samsung account in the "Samsung Health" app.
